/**handles:brands-styles,ekran-all,searchwp-forms**/
.tax-product_brand .brand-description{overflow:hidden;zoom:1}.tax-product_brand .brand-description img.brand-thumbnail{width:25%;float:right}.tax-product_brand .brand-description .text{width:72%;float:left}.widget_brand_description img{box-sizing:border-box;width:100%;max-width:none;height:auto;margin:0 0 1em}ul.brand-thumbnails{margin-left:0;margin-bottom:0;clear:both;list-style:none}ul.brand-thumbnails:before{clear:both;content:"";display:table}ul.brand-thumbnails:after{clear:both;content:"";display:table}ul.brand-thumbnails li{float:left;margin:0 3.8% 1em 0;padding:0;position:relative;width:22.05%}ul.brand-thumbnails.fluid-columns li{width:auto}ul.brand-thumbnails:not(.fluid-columns) li.first{clear:both}ul.brand-thumbnails:not(.fluid-columns) li.last{margin-right:0}ul.brand-thumbnails.columns-1 li{width:100%;margin-right:0}ul.brand-thumbnails.columns-2 li{width:48%}ul.brand-thumbnails.columns-3 li{width:30.75%}ul.brand-thumbnails.columns-5 li{width:16.95%}ul.brand-thumbnails.columns-6 li{width:13.5%}.brand-thumbnails li img{box-sizing:border-box;width:100%;max-width:none;height:auto;margin:0}@media screen and (max-width:768px){ul.brand-thumbnails:not(.fluid-columns) li{width:48%!important}ul.brand-thumbnails:not(.fluid-columns) li.first{clear:none}ul.brand-thumbnails:not(.fluid-columns) li.last{margin-right:3.8%}ul.brand-thumbnails:not(.fluid-columns) li:nth-of-type(odd){clear:both}ul.brand-thumbnails:not(.fluid-columns) li:nth-of-type(2n){margin-right:0}}.brand-thumbnails-description li{text-align:center}.brand-thumbnails-description li .term-thumbnail img{display:inline}.brand-thumbnails-description li .term-description{margin-top:1em;text-align:left}#brands_a_z h3:target{text-decoration:underline}ul.brands_index{list-style:none outside;overflow:hidden;zoom:1}ul.brands_index li{float:left;margin:0 2px 2px 0}ul.brands_index li a,ul.brands_index li span{border:1px solid #ccc;padding:6px;line-height:1em;float:left;text-decoration:none}ul.brands_index li span{border-color:#eee;color:#ddd}ul.brands_index li a:hover{border-width:2px;padding:5px;text-decoration:none}ul.brands_index li a.active{border-width:2px;padding:5px}div#brands_a_z a.top{border:1px solid #ccc;padding:4px;line-height:1em;float:right;text-decoration:none;font-size:.8em}
.tcp-content.single-item table tr td{height:auto!important}.tcp-content.single-item .table-headings td{border:0!important}.tcp-content.single-item table .head_left-td{width:50%!important;border:1px solid #000!important;height:auto!important;padding:10px 20px!important}@media only screen and (max-width:767px){.tcp-content.single-item table .head_left-td{width:100%!important;display:block}}.tcp-content.single-item table .head_right-td{padding:0!important}.tcp-content.single-item .head_right-td table{border:0!important}.tcp-content.single-item .head_right-td table td{padding:0!important;border:0!important}.tcp-content.single-item h1{margin-bottom:50px}.tcp-content.single-item table.table-headings{margin-bottom:50px;min-height:0}.tcp-content.single-item .field-value{text-align:right}.tcp-content.single-item .totals-left-td{width:50%}@media only screen and (max-width:767px){.tcp-content.single-item .totals-left-td{width:auto;display:none}}.tcp-content.single-item .totals-left-td,.tcp-content.single-item .totals-right-td{border:0!important}.tcp-content.single-item .table-totals{margin-bottom:50px}.tcp-shortcode .single-item .btn,.tcp-shortcode .single-item .tcp-back,.tcp-shortcode .tcp-actions button[type=submit]{background:-webkit-gradient(linear,left top,left bottom,from(#ff7e21),to(#e66a1e));background:linear-gradient(to bottom,#ff7e21 0,#e66a1e 100%);border-radius:25px;-webkit-transition:all .3s;transition:all .3s;position:relative;z-index:5;padding:12px 19px 16px;border-width:2px;border-radius:25px;font-size:14px;line-height:18px;font-weight:700;white-space:normal;border:none;color:#fff;max-width:180px;min-width:180px;margin-top:10px}.tcp-content.single-item h1{font-size:38px}@media (min-width:768px){.tcp-content.single-item h1{text-indent:120px}}@media (min-width:1350px){.tcp-content.single-item h1{text-indent:150px}}.tcp-content.single-item table{min-height:0!important}.tcp-shortcode.tcp-shortcode-customer-ledger .tcp-content table{min-height:0}#single-item h1{text-indent:150px}#single-item .table-headings{width:100%;margin-bottom:20mm}#single-item .table-headings td{width:5mm}#single-item .table-headings .head_left-td{width:60mm;vertical-align:middle;text-align:left;padding:3mm 5mm;border:1px solid #000}#single-item .table-headings .head_right-td{width:60mm;padding:3mm 0 3mm 0}#single-item .table-headings .head_right-td .field-value{text-align:right}#single-item .content_sales-group-table{width:100%;margin-bottom:20mm}#single-item .content_sales-group-table td{border-top:0 solid #000;font-size:10pt}#single-item .content_sales-group-table th{text-align:left;font-size:10pt;background:0 0}#single-item .content_sales-group-table tr{border:0!important;padding:0;margin:0}#single-item .content_sales-group-table tr>td{border:0;margin:0;padding:12px 7px!important;border-bottom:0!important}#single-item .content_sales-group-table tr>th{margin:0;padding:3px 7px}#single-item .content_sales-group-table tr>th{border:1px solid #000!important;border-left:0!important}#single-item .content_sales-group-table tr>th:first-child{border-left:1px solid #000!important}#single-item .content_sales-group-table tr>td{border-top:0}#single-item .content_sales-group-table tr>td:first-child{border-left:0}#single-item .table-totals{width:100%}#single-item .table-totals td{border-bottom:0!important}#single-item .table-totals .totals-left-td{width:80mm}#single-item .table-totals .totals-right-td{width:60mm}#single-item .table-totals .field-value{text-align:right}#single-item .print-footer{margin-top:30px}#single-item .print-footer table{border:0!important;border-left:1px solid orange!important;width:auto}#single-item .print-footer table td{padding:3px 15px;font-size:11pt;border:0!important}
.swp-flex--col{display:flex;flex-direction:column;flex-grow:1}form.searchwp-form .swp-flex--row{align-items:center;display:flex;flex-direction:row;flex-grow:1;flex-wrap:nowrap;justify-content:flex-start}form.searchwp-form .swp-flex--wrap{flex-wrap:wrap}form.searchwp-form .swp-flex--gap-sm{gap:.25em}form.searchwp-form .swp-flex--gap-md{gap:.5em}form.searchwp-form .swp-items-stretch{align-items:stretch}form.searchwp-form .swp-margin-l-auto{margin-left:auto}form.searchwp-form input.swp-input,form.searchwp-form select.swp-select{color:rgba(14,33,33,.8)}form.searchwp-form select.swp-select{appearance:none;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='17' height='11' fill='none'%3E%3Cpath fill='%230E2121' fill-opacity='.8' d='M14.292.814 8.096 6.958 1.903.814 0 2.706l8.097 8.049 8.097-8.05z'/%3E%3C/svg%3E");background-position:right 12px top 50%;background-repeat:no-repeat;background-size:12px auto;min-height:2em;min-width:fit-content;padding:0 33px 0 .7em}form.searchwp-form input.swp-input--search{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='15' height='15' fill='none'%3E%3Cpath fill='%23CFCFCF' d='M6.068 12.136c1.31 0 2.533-.426 3.527-1.136l3.74 3.74c.174.173.402.26.64.26.512 0 .883-.395.883-.9a.87.87 0 0 0-.253-.63L10.89 9.744a6.04 6.04 0 0 0 1.247-3.677C12.136 2.73 9.406 0 6.068 0 2.722 0 0 2.73 0 6.068s2.722 6.068 6.068 6.068m0-1.31c-2.612 0-4.758-2.154-4.758-4.758S3.456 1.31 6.068 1.31c2.604 0 4.758 2.154 4.758 4.758s-2.154 4.758-4.758 4.758'/%3E%3C/svg%3E");background-position:right 12px top 50%;background-repeat:no-repeat;background-size:15px auto;padding-left:.7em;padding-right:38px}form.searchwp-form .searchwp-form-input-container{display:flex;flex-direction:row;flex-grow:1;flex-wrap:nowrap;justify-content:flex-start}form.searchwp-form .searchwp-form-input-container .swp-input{margin:0;width:100%}form.searchwp-form .searchwp-form-input-container .swp-select{border-right:0}form.searchwp-form .searchwp-form-input-container .swp-select+.swp-input{flex-grow:1}form.searchwp-form .searchwp-form-advanced-filters-toggle{text-align:right}form.searchwp-form .searchwp-form-advanced-filters select{flex:1}form.searchwp-form .swp-toggle{cursor:pointer;margin-bottom:0}form.searchwp-form .swp-toggle-switch{background-color:rgba(14,33,33,.14);border-radius:20px;height:22px;position:relative;transition:background-color .25s;width:40px}form.searchwp-form .swp-toggle-switch:not(.swp-toggle-switch--mini):hover{background-color:rgba(14,33,33,.2)}form.searchwp-form .swp-toggle-switch--mini{height:15px;width:25px}form.searchwp-form .swp-toggle-switch:after,form.searchwp-form .swp-toggle-switch:before{content:""}form.searchwp-form .swp-toggle-switch:before{background:#fff;border-radius:50%;display:block;height:18px;left:2px;position:absolute;top:2px;-webkit-transition:left .25s;-o-transition:left .25s;transition:left .25s;width:18px}form.searchwp-form .swp-toggle-switch--mini:before{height:11px;left:2px;top:2px;width:11px}form.searchwp-form .swp-toggle-checkbox:checked+.swp-toggle-switch,form.searchwp-form .swp-toggle-switch--checked{background:currentcolor}form.searchwp-form .swp-toggle-checkbox:checked+.swp-toggle-switch:before{left:20px}form.searchwp-form .swp-toggle-checkbox:checked+.swp-toggle-switch--mini:before,form.searchwp-form .swp-toggle-switch--checked.swp-toggle-switch--mini:before{left:12px}form.searchwp-form input.swp-toggle-checkbox{-webkit-appearance:none;-moz-appearance:none;appearance:none;border:none;height:0;overflow:hidden;position:absolute;width:0}form.searchwp-form input.swp-toggle-checkbox:focus{border:none;box-shadow:none;outline:none}form.searchwp-form .swp-toggle .swp-label{display:block;margin-top:21px}form.searchwp-form input.swp-toggle-checkbox:active+.swp-toggle-switch,form.searchwp-form input.swp-toggle-checkbox:focus+.swp-toggle-switch{border:none;-webkit-box-shadow:0 0 1px 1px rgba(14,33,33,.14);box-shadow:0 0 1px 1px rgba(14,33,33,.14)}